Meta Launches Muse Spark 1.1 API, Igniting a Massive AI Price War
Meta has officially entered the developer API arena with the release of Muse Spark 1.1, a multimodal reasoning model designed specifically for complex agent-based tasks. By pairing high-performance reasoning with aggressive pricing, Meta is directly challenging the market dominance of OpenAI and Anthropic.
Muse Spark 1.1: A Powerhouse for Multi-Agent Orchestration
The Muse Spark 1.1 model represents a significant leap in agentic workflows, focusing on "Thinking" capabilities for coding, computer use, and multimodal understanding. Unlike standard LLMs, Muse Spark 1.1 is engineered to act as a primary orchestrator in multi-agent systems. It can gather context, build strategic plans, and delegate execution to parallel subagents, all while managing a massive one-million-token context window.
The model's technical prowess is reflected in its benchmark performance. Muse Spark 1.1 leads the MCP Atlas benchmark with a score of 88.1 and Humanity's Last Exam with 62.1, outpacing heavyweights like Anthropic’s Opus 4.8, OpenAI’s GPT 5.5, and Google’s Gemini 3.1 Pro. On the Vibe Code Bench, the model saw a massive jump of 36 places compared to its predecessor, signaling a major upgrade in real-world coding and enterprise system management.
A Paradigm Shift in AI Pricing Strategy
While the model's intelligence is impressive, the launch of the Meta Model API is the true industry disruptor. Meta has set a new price floor for frontier-level models that puts immense pressure on specialized AI labs.
Meta’s pricing structure is remarkably lean:
- Input Tokens: $1.25 per million
- Output Tokens: $4.25 per million
- Cached Input: $0.15 per million
- Web Search Grounding: $2.50 per 1,000 queries
To put this in perspective, competitors like Anthropic (Opus 4.8) and OpenAI (GPT 5.5) charge between $25 and $50 per million output tokens. Meta’s rates are not just lower than these leaders; they even undercut xAI’s Grok 4.5. This move leverages Meta’s massive $60 billion annual profit to compete in a way that high-burn startups like OpenAI may find difficult to sustain.
The "Squeeze" Effect on the AI Landscape
The entry of Meta into the API market creates a "pincer movement" on existing AI providers. On one side, Chinese models like GLM 5.2 are driving prices down from the bottom with extremely low-cost, high-performance open-source alternatives. On the other side, Meta and Google are utilizing their vast corporate resources to offer competitive models as gateways to their broader ecosystems.
This price war forces a shift in how developers and founders choose their stack. As companies like Coinbase and Lindy have already demonstrated by switching to cheaper models, the industry is moving toward a reality where intelligence is becoming a commodity. The winners will no longer just be the ones with the highest benchmarks, but those who can balance reasoning capabilities with extreme token efficiency and cost-effectiveness.
